嘿,朋友们!今天我想和你聊聊一个很酷的话题:区块链钱包编译。也许你一听这词就觉得高深莫测,没事,我也曾经这样觉得。不过嘛,自己动手编译一个区块链钱包,不仅能帮你更好地理解这门技术,还能增强你的安全性,毕竟,钱包在区块链世界里可是至关重要的一环啊!
首先,咱们得准备一些必须的工具。在开始之前,确保你有一个可靠的开发环境。以下是一些你需要的东西:
还可以找一找GitHub上的开源项目,有很多现成的代码可以用哦!比如比特币钱包或者以太坊钱包的源码,都是很好的学习材料。
接下来,咱们需要弄到钱包的源码。像比特币这样的项目,通常都有开源的代码,大家都可以自由使用。去GitHub上搜索一下,找适合你的钱包。记得先看看README文档,里面可以找到编译和安装的具体步骤。
假如你选的是比特币钱包,直接clone这个项目:
git clone https://github.com/bitcoin/bitcoin.git
一旦源码下载完成,我们得安装一些依赖。这些可是让钱包正常运行的基础,别不在意哦!以比特币钱包为例,具体依赖可能包括Boost库、OpenSSL、libevent等。
可以在项目的文档里找到详细的依赖列表,然后按需安装。常用的命令如下(以Ubuntu为例):
sudo apt-get install build-essential libtool autotools-dev automake pkg-config libssl-dev libevent-dev
好,准备工作都做好了,咱们终于可以开始编译啦!这一步有点小复杂,但不要怕,跟着步骤来就行了。
在终端里切换到钱包源码的目录,通常是这样的:
cd ~/bitcoin
然后,执行以下命令来配置构建环境:
./autogen.sh
./configure
再接着,你可以开始编译了!直接输入:
make
这通常需要一点时间,但如果一切顺利,你会看到“完成”的提示!
编译完成后,别急着高兴,接下来还得进行安装。我们可以直接用make命令完成:
sudo make install
这样你就可以在命令行中输入钱包的命令了,试试运行一下,看看是否成功!
在玩区块链钱包的时候,热钱包和冷钱包这两个词常常会出现,想必你听说过吧?热钱包是在线的,方便快捷,但安全性相对较低;冷钱包是离线的,安全但不方便。
依据自己的需求选择适合的类型。比如,如果你打算频繁交易,选择热钱包是个不错的选择;但如果想长期保存资产,冷钱包就更合适了。你可以考虑将大部分资产存入冷钱包,只留少量在热钱包中交易。
自己编译的钱包虽然厉害,但安全问题可不能忽视。这里给你几个小贴士:
好了,朋友们,自从开始这段编译钱包的旅程,我觉得自己仿佛打开了一个新世界。这个过程不仅让我了解了区块链的原理,更让我对技术有了更深的体验。
或许一开始会有点困难,但只要坚持下去,你就会慢慢掌握这些技能。而且,未来区块链的发展依然是一个方向,你自己动手可以更好地适应这个领域的变化。
如果你在编译过程中遇到问题,别担心,可以随时去相关论坛、GitHub或者微信群里求助。相信我,大家都是互相学习、互相帮助的。
说不定有一天,你编译的钱包会成为朋友们争相使用的工具,想想就觉得开心!加油,继续探索吧!
2003-2026 波币钱包下载app @版权所有 |网站地图|桂ICP备2022008651号-1